Durango upgrades - xenons, cpu & cold air intake

Hi all,

Just purchased a 99 Durango (4x4 5.2L) and am wanting to toss some cash into it right from the start.

I'm wondering if there is a "true" xenon upgrade? I'm not talking those (slightly more expensive) blue lights you can buy anywhere, but the real deal. Anyone know of a package out there?

Also, I've seen the chips you can get out there to increase performance, but does anyone know if there's a model that keeps a remote in the cabin, so you can change between preset programs on the fly? I saw this on TV for another vehicle and am wondering if anyone's seen one for the Durangos.

Lastly, would anyone steer me away from the inexpensive cold air intake systems available online and in shops, versus the expensive name brand ones? I just don't have any first hand experience with them.

Thanks for any posts!

Mark,

Personally I'd leave it stock/as is. My cold air box is pretty good as is. Just keep/change/replace the air cleaner filter when it get dirty and you'll be a happy camper. To use any other will just make the engine more noisey.

For your head lights these fancy xeon lights are just an expense that your pocket book might not handle. Their more brighter for the road but they burn out faster!!!!

Chips for the computer might be OK for your needs. Although I don't have them I much prefer mine as is. It's been well noted that chips will change the engines performance. How often you need economy/power will be up to you.

My firm suggestion would be to switch over to a good synthetic oil for the engine.
